An Online Gambling Dictionary

Regardless of the actuality that online wagering is now a multi-billion dollar industry, and countless thousands of new players around the globe sign on every day to bet at web gambling halls, there are additionally millions of newcomers to the environment of online betting who do not as yet have a clear comprehension of much of the doublespeak used in internet betting, and betting on athletics in general. Nonetheless, knowledge of these ideas is necessary to interpreting the games and regulations of gambling:

ACTION: Any style of bet.

ALL-IN: In poker, all-in alludes to a gambler has risked all of her bankroll into the pot. A side pot is developed for the players with remaining money.

ALL-UP: To wager on several horses in the identical race.

ANTE: A poker phrase for allocating a required sum of chips into the pot beforeeach hand starts.

BRING-IN: A required bet in 7-card stud made by the gambler displaying the lowest value card.

BUST: You do not win; As in 21, when a gambler’s cards are valued over twenty-one.

BUY-IN: The minimum amount of money necessary to appear in a game or event.

CALL: As in poker, when a wager equals an already carried out bet.

CHECK: In poker, to remain in the match and not betting. This is acceptable only if no other gamblers wager in that round.

CLOSING A BET: As in spread wagering, meaning to lay a bet on par with but opposite of the starting wager.

COLUMN BET: To wager on one or more of the 3 columns of a roulette table.

COME BET: In craps, the same as a pass-line bet, but carried out after the shooter has arrived at their number.

COME-OUT ROLL: A crapshooters 1st toss to arrive at a number, or the 1st roll after a number has been ascertained.

COVERALL: A bingo term, which means to fill all the spots on a bingo sheet.

CRAPPING OUT: In craps, to toss a 2, 3 or twelve is an immediate defeat on the come-out roll.

DAILY DOUBLE: To select the champions of the first two matches of the night.

DOWN BET: To bet that the result of an event will be lower than the smallest end of the quote on a spread bet, also known as a "sell".

DOZEN BET: In roulette, to bet on one or more of 3 categories of 12 numbers, one-twelve, etc.

EACH WAY BET: A athletic event gamble, meaning to wager on a team or player to win or medal in a match.

EVEN MONEY BET: A bet that pays out the same value as wagered, ( one to one ).

EXACTA: gambling that 2 horses in a race will complete the race in the absolute same assignment as the bet – also known as a " Perfecta ".

FIVE-NUMBER LINE BET: In roulette, a wager carried out on a group of 5 numbers, for instance 1-2-3-0, and 00.

Illinois gambling dens

Illinois is home to water based gambling dens, and there are nine key gambling halls in Illinois. Illinois casinos have been constrained by the government’s limitations and are taxed at the highest percentage in the US. The restrictions also limit the number of gaming licenses that are able to be distributed to 9, and the state government is today at the max for casino lics. Illinois casinos do, however, present a vast range of wagering options.

Illinois was the 5th commonwealth allowed into to the Country on Dec third, 1818 and it is the 5th biggest populated state in the union. With the building of the Alton Belle, Illinois became the 2nd state to permit paddle wheel boat gambling halls. All of the casinos offer fantastic gaming from one armed bandits to chemin de fer to Roulette.

Argosy’s Alton Belle Casino was the 1st paddle wheel boat gambling den in Illinois, opening for business in 1991. It’s based at One Front St. in Alton. 3 eatery’s accessible for clients. The gambling den occupies 23,000 square feet and highlights a twelve hundred patron ship and a barge.

Argosy’s Empress gambling den is situated at 2300 Empress Dr. in Joliet. There are eighty-five rooms and seventeen penthouses close-by at the casino inn. There are three dining rooms close by. The gambling den covers fifty thousand square feet, and has exclusive features like an 80-lot camper camp and two thousand, five hundred passenger flatboat.

Casino Queen is situated in East Saint Louis at two hundred South Front Street. A total of one hundred and fifty bedrooms and 7 penthouses close-by at the gambling den. The casino coverstwenty-seven five hundred sq.ft. and provides numerous features. Besides playing, Casino Queen presents a 2,500 passenger paddle wheeler, a one hundred and forty spot RV park and simple access to MetroLink light-train location.

These are only 3 of the 9 Illinois casinos. They all provide special highlights like riverboats and barges. The majority gambling dens also put forth exceptional dining on site. Illinois gambling dens provide far more than wagering – they provide an awesome holiday opportunity.
